Series Analysis:
The 2002 He-Man and the Masters of the Universe revival stands as a bold reimagining that traded camp for complex world-building. Produced by Mike Young Productions, this series successfully transitioned Eternia from a neon-colored toy commercial into a high-stakes fantasy realm. By exploring the tragic origin of Keldor and providing actual combat utility to the Heroic Warriors, the show earned deep respect from enthusiasts. Its legacy remains defined by a sophisticated narrative structure that paved the way for modern serialized animation. Though cut short by toy marketing shifts, its influence persists in how legacy franchises approach reboots today.
